AU - Upgang, Lucia AU - Rehage, Jürgen PY - 2013 DA - 2013/06/27 TI - Prevalence and consequences of subacute ruminal acidosis in German dairy herds JO - Acta Veterinaria Scandinavica SP - 48 VL - 55 IS - 1 AB - The prevalence and the clinical consequences of subacute ruminal acidosis (SARA) in dairy cows are still poorly understood. In order to evaluate the prevalence of SARA, 26 German dairy farms were included in a field study. In each herd, between 11 and 14 lactating dairy cows were examined for their ruminal pH using rumenocentesis. Milk production data and farm management characteristics were recorded. Each farm was scored for lameness prevalence among lactating animals, and body condition score was recorded three times four to five weeks apart in all animals examined. Farms were grouped on basis of ruminal pH and compared for lameness, body condition, milk production parameters and style of management. Animals were grouped on basis of their measured ruminal pH and compared accordingly for milk production parameters and body condition score.
